Sri Lanka appeals to Tamils to flee to govt territory
August 28, 2008 (AFP) – Sri Lanka on Thursday appealed to minority ethnic Tamil civilians living in the line of fire in rebel-held towns to move to areas under government control, saying it would guarantee them safe passage. Dubai port operator profits more than double in H1
DUBAI, August 28, 2008 (AFP) – Dubai-based port operator DP World posted on Thursday a 123 percent increase in net profits in the first half of 2008, which hit 287 million dollars, despite a global economic slowdown. ASEAN concludes free trade deal with India: ministers
SINGAPORE, August 28, 2008 (AFP) – Southeast Asian nations have concluded a deal for free trade in goods with India, ministers said Thursday, in a development hailed as a key regional milestone after hard negotiations. Sri Lanka T-bill yeilds edge down
Aug 27, 2008 (LBO) – Sri Lanka’s Treasury bills yields fell at Wednesday’s auction with 6-month bills falling 29 basis points to 18.01 percent and one year yields falling 5 basis points to 18.60 percent. Sri Lanka stocks firmer, heavy trading in AMW, JKH
Aug 27, 2008 (LBO) – Sri Lankan stocks ended a shade firmer and turnover increased to almost half-a-billion rupees with strategic buying seen in Associated Motorways (AMW) and heavy trading in John Keells Holdings (JKH), brokers said. Capital Gains
Aug 27, 2008 (LBO) – Sri Lanka’s DFFC Bank net profit for the June quarter rose 30 percent to 515 million rupees from 395 million rupees a year ago, helped by capital gains from the sale of shares, the bank’s interim results show. Sri Lanka cloves exports seen hitting new high
Aug 27, 2008 (LBO) – Exports of cloves from Sri Lanka are seen hitting a record 5,000 tonnes this year with earnings exceeding three billion rupees, a trade body said. Sri Lanka says regional deal will help combat terrorist financing
Aug 27, 2008 (LBO) – A legal co-operation deal signed by south Asian leaders at a summit in Sri Lanka earlier this month will help combat terrorist financing and cross-border crime, the foreign affairs ministry said Wednesday.
